sagas

[US]/ˈsɑːɡəz/
[UK]/ˈsæɡəz/
Frequency: Very High

Translation

n.long stories of adventures and heroic deeds, especially from ancient Norway or Iceland; a long story recounting events that occurred over many years; a series of events or experiences; a narrative of a series of experiences
